Before casting your line, equip yourself with the essential gear. Choose a rod and reel combination suitable for the target species and fishing conditions. Select lures or bait that mimic the natural prey of your quarry, enhancing your chances of success. Remember to secure a valid fishing license, respecting local regulations and conservation efforts.
Scouting potential fishing spots is crucial for maximizing your catch. Observe the water's depth, clarity, and structure to identify likely fish habitats. Look for areas with submerged vegetation, rock outcroppings, or fallen trees, which provide cover and attract baitfish. Don't hesitate to ask local anglers for advice or recommendations, as they often possess valuable knowledge about the area's fish populations.
When casting your line, accuracy and precision are paramount. Aim to cast into areas with high fish activity or near visible cover. Pay attention to the wind direction and adjust your cast accordingly. Experiment with different retrieves to entice strikes. Slow and steady retrieves can be effective for cautious fish, while faster retrieves may trigger aggressive strikes. Be patient and experiment until you find the retrieval that yields the most success.
Once a fish is hooked, the battle is only half won. Play the fish with finesse, using your rod and reel to apply steady pressure while avoiding sudden jerks or excessive force. If the fish makes a strong run, loosen the drag slightly to prevent the line from snapping. Time your net and landing with precision, ensuring the fish is securely secured without causing unnecessary harm.
Practicing catch-and-release is an essential component of responsible fishing, promoting the conservation of fish populations for future generations. Carefully unhook the fish, minimizing injury, and return it to the water gently. Handle the fish with wet hands to protect its sensitive skin and reduce stress. If you intend to keep your catch, follow local regulations and size limits to ensure sustainable fishing practices.
